/*! tailwindcss v4.1.12 | MIT License | https://tailwindcss.com */
@layer properties{@supports ((-webkit-hyphens:none)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){*,:before,:after,::backdrop{--tw-font-weight:initial;--tw-content:"";--tw-border-style:solid;--tw-shadow:0 0 #0000;--tw-shadow-color:initial;--tw-shadow-alpha:100%;--tw-inset-shadow:0 0 #0000;--tw-inset-shadow-color:initial;--tw-inset-shadow-alpha:100%;--tw-ring-color:initial;--tw-ring-shadow:0 0 #0000;--tw-inset-ring-color:initial;--tw-inset-ring-shadow:0 0 #0000;--tw-ring-inset:initial;--tw-ring-offset-width:0px;--tw-ring-offset-color:#fff;--tw-ring-offset-shadow:0 0 #0000}}}@layer theme,base;@layer components{section.contact-area-form .content-form h4{font-size:1rem;line-height:var(--tw-leading,1.5rem);--tw-font-weight:700;padding-top:0;padding-left:84px;font-weight:700;position:relative}section.contact-area-form .content-form h4:after{content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);--tw-content:"";content:var(--tw-content);width:4rem;height:2px;position:absolute;top:50%;left:0}section.contact-area-form .content-form h5{font-size:1rem;line-height:var(--tw-leading,1.5rem)}section.contact-area-form .content-form hr{border-top-style:var(--tw-border-style);border-top-width:2px;margin-block:1.5rem}section.contact-area-form a[href^=mailto\:]{--tw-font-weight:700;font-weight:700}section.contact-area-form hubspot-form form label{padding-bottom:.75rem;display:block}section.contact-area-form hubspot-form form div.input{margin-bottom:.75rem}section.contact-area-form hubspot-form form div.input input:not(.hs-form-booleancheckbox-display input):not(.hs-form-checkbox input),section.contact-area-form hubspot-form form div.input textarea,section.contact-area-form hubspot-form form div.input select{background-color:#000e290a;border-color:#000e290a;width:100%}section.contact-area-form hubspot-form form div.input input,section.contact-area-form hubspot-form form div.input textarea{background-color:#000e290a;border-color:#000e290a;border-style:var(--tw-border-style)!important;--tw-border-style:solid!important;font-size:.875rem!important;line-height:var(--tw-leading,1.25rem)!important;border-style:solid!important;border-width:1px!important;border-radius:.5rem!important;padding-block:.75rem!important;padding-inline:1rem!important}section.contact-area-form hubspot-form form div.input input::-moz-placeholder, section.contact-area-form hubspot-form form div.input textarea::-moz-placeholder{color:#6f6f71}section.contact-area-form hubspot-form form div.input input::placeholder,section.contact-area-form hubspot-form form div.input textarea::placeholder{color:#6f6f71}section.contact-area-form hubspot-form form div.input input:hover,section.contact-area-form hubspot-form form div.input input:focus,section.contact-area-form hubspot-form form div.input textarea:hover,section.contact-area-form hubspot-form form div.input textarea:focus{--tw-ring-shadow:var(--tw-ring-inset,)0 0 0 calc(3px + var(--tw-ring-offset-width))var(--tw-ring-color,currentcolor)!important;box-shadow:var(--tw-inset-shadow),var(--tw-inset-ring-shadow),var(--tw-ring-offset-shadow),var(--tw-ring-shadow),var(--tw-shadow)!important}section.contact-area-form hubspot-form form div.input select{background-color:#000e290a;background-position:calc(100% - 1rem);border-color:#000e290a;-webkit-appearance:none!important;-moz-appearance:none!important;appearance:none!important;border-style:var(--tw-border-style)!important;padding-block:.75rem!important;padding-inline:1rem!important;background-repeat:no-repeat!important;border-width:1px!important;border-radius:.5rem!important;padding-right:2rem!important}section.contact-area-form hubspot-form form div.input .hs-form-checkbox label{padding-bottom:0}section.contact-area-form hubspot-form form div.input .hs-form-checkbox label span{font-size:.875rem;line-height:var(--tw-leading,1.25rem);margin-left:.5rem}section.contact-area-form hubspot-form form button: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=button]: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=reset]: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=submit]:not(.pika-button):not(.pika-prev):not(.pika-next){border-style:var(--tw-border-style);width:100%;font-size:1.25rem;line-height:var(--tw-leading,1.75rem);color:#fff;transition-property:color,background-color,border-color,outline-color,text-decoration-color,fill,stroke,--tw-gradient-from,--tw-gradient-via,--tw-gradient-to;transition-timing-function:var(--tw-ease,ease);transition-duration:var(--tw-duration,0s);background-color:#000e29;border-width:3px;border-color:#000e29;border-radius:9999px;justify-content:center;align-items:center;padding-block:1rem;padding-inline:1.5rem;display:inline-flex;position:relative}@media (hover:hover){:is(section.contact-area-form hubspot-form form button: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=button]: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=reset]:not(.pika-button):not(.pika-prev):not(.pika-next),section.contact-area-form hubspot-form form input[type=submit]:not(.pika-button):not(.pika-prev):not(.pika-next)):hover{color:#fff;background-color:#626a7b;border-color:#626a7b}}section.contact-area-form hubspot-form form .hs-form-field .hs-error-msgs .hs-error-msg{color:#dc2626;font-size:.875rem!important;line-height:var(--tw-leading,1.25rem)!important}section.contact-area-form hubspot-form form .hs-form-booleancheckbox-display,section.contact-area-form hubspot-form form .hs-form-booleancheckbox-display input{margin-top:.5rem}section.contact-area-form hubspot-form form .hs-form-booleancheckbox-display p{font-size:.875rem;line-height:var(--tw-leading,1.25rem)}section.contact-area-form hubspot-form form .hs-richtext{font-size:.875rem;line-height:var(--tw-leading,1.25rem);padding-bottom:.75rem}section.contact-area-form hubspot-form form .hs-richtext h1{font-size:1rem;line-height:var(--tw-leading,1.5rem);--tw-font-weight:700;margin-bottom:2rem;padding-top:0;padding-left:84px;font-weight:700;position:relative}section.contact-area-form hubspot-form form .hs-richtext h1:after{content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);content:var(--tw-content);--tw-content:"";content:var(--tw-content);width:4rem;height:2px;position:absolute;top:50%;left:0}section.contact-area-form .hs-button{align-items:center;gap:.75rem;display:inline-flex}section.contact-area-form .hs-button .arrow{background:url(../components/d33120c5220881428b17.svg) 50%/contain no-repeat;width:20px;height:20px}}@layer utilities;@property --tw-font-weight{syntax:"*";inherits:false}@property --tw-content{syntax:"*";inherits:false;initial-value:""}@property --tw-border-style{syntax:"*";inherits:false;initial-value:solid}@property --tw-shadow{syntax:"*";inherits:false;initial-value:0 0 #0000}@property --tw-shadow-color{syntax:"*";inherits:false}@property --tw-shadow-alpha{syntax:"<percentage>";inherits:false;initial-value:100%}@property --tw-inset-shadow{syntax:"*";inherits:false;initial-value:0 0 #0000}@property --tw-inset-shadow-color{syntax:"*";inherits:false}@property --tw-inset-shadow-alpha{syntax:"<percentage>";inherits:false;initial-value:100%}@property --tw-ring-color{syntax:"*";inherits:false}@property --tw-ring-shadow{syntax:"*";inherits:false;initial-value:0 0 #0000}@property --tw-inset-ring-color{syntax:"*";inherits:false}@property --tw-inset-ring-shadow{syntax:"*";inherits:false;initial-value:0 0 #0000}@property --tw-ring-inset{syntax:"*";inherits:false}@property --tw-ring-offset-width{syntax:"<length>";inherits:false;initial-value:0}@property --tw-ring-offset-color{syntax:"*";inherits:false;initial-value:#fff}@property --tw-ring-offset-shadow{syntax:"*";inherits:false;initial-value:0 0 #0000}
